The lightest supersymmetric (SUSY) particle is a preferred candidate for the cold dark matter of the universe. Accelerator experiments give a lower limit for the mass of the lightest SUSY particle of about 40 GeV. The GLAST properties including a large collection area combined with an excellent energy resolution are important for searches for gamma-ray signals from SUSY dark matter particles annihilation. A large range in SUSY masses and different dark matter halo distributions can be examined.
